How to Clean Your Tote Bag: Step-by-Step Guide
Spot Cleaning for Everyday Dirt
Sometimes, a tote needs a little touch-up. Spot cleaning removes minor stains and dirt without a full wash.
- What You Need: Mild detergent, a soft brush, and water.
- Steps:
- Mix a small amount of detergent with warm water.
- Dip the brush in the soapy solution and gently scrub the stained area.
- Wipe the area with a clean, damp cloth and let it air dry.
Machine Washing Canvas or Fabric Totes
Many canvas and cotton tote bags can withstand a gentle machine wash.
- Steps:
- Turn the bag inside out to protect any prints or designs.
- Use a gentle cycle with cold water and mild detergent.
- Let the bag air dry, and avoid using the dryer, which can cause shrinking or distortion.
Caring for Leather or Faux Leather Totes
Leather totes require special care to prevent cracking and discoloration.
- What You Need: Leather cleaner, soft cloth, and conditioner.
- Steps:
- Wipe the surface with a damp cloth to remove dust.
- Apply a leather cleaner using circular motions.
- Finish with a leather conditioner to maintain the material’s softness and shine.
How to Handle Stubborn Stains
For tough stains like ink or grease, try these hacks:
- Ink: Use rubbing alcohol on a cotton swab and dab gently.
- Oil/Grease: Apply baking soda and let it sit overnight to absorb the grease, then brush it off.
Proper Storage to Prevent Damage
Store your tote bags in a cool, dry place when not in use. Avoid folding leather totes to prevent creases, and stuff them with tissue paper to maintain their shape.
FAQs
Can I put my tote bag in the washing machine?
Yes, but only if made from canvas, cotton, or other machine-washable fabrics. Always use a gentle cycle.
How do I remove odors from my tote bag?
Sprinkle baking soda inside the bag and leave it overnight, then shake it out the next day.
How often should I clean my tote bag?
Clean it monthly or as soon as you notice stains or odors. Regular light cleaning helps avoid deep cleaning sessions.
Can leather totes be cleaned with water?
Use water sparingly on leather, and always follow with a conditioner to prevent drying or cracking.
How do I protect printed designs on tote bags?
Turn the bag inside for washing and avoid harsh scrubbing over printed areas.
